When Silence Speaks: The Fed's Communication Vacuum and Its Hidden Ledger for Crypto Markets

The data shows a 10-year Treasury yield at a 19-year high while the Fed Chair signals a reduced commitment to forward guidance. This is not a coincidence. It's a structural shift in how policy uncertainty transmits to risk assets, and the crypto market is far more exposed than most analysts admit. I spent the past week tracing the flow of this macro uncertainty into on-chain activity. The correlation between Fed communication gaps and crypto volatility is not just a narrative — it is now a measurable pattern. When the central bank stops giving guidance, the market doesn't get quieter. It gets louder. And it doesn't just guess; it prices the worst case. My base case: we are entering a period of 'communicative tightening' that will test the resilience of every risk asset, especially crypto, which has no rate shield. The Jackson Hole speech is not just a risk event. It is the first test of this new framework. The broader context is clear. The U.S. public debt has broken the $40 trillion barrier. The Treasury Secretary is expanding a buyback program in an attempt to control the yield curve. The threat of tariffs on Canada and sanctions on Iran looms as an external shock. These are not isolated policy levers. They are a ledger of interconnected obligations. And the book is not balancing. Here is the part that matters for our sector. As a data analyst, I've built dashboards that track stablecoin inflows and outflows in response to macro events. When the 10-year yield makes a decisive move, I see a corresponding move in the liquidity flows of the major stablecoins. It's not always immediate. But it is always there, a kind of echo on the blockchain. The risk tolerance doesn't vanish. It migrates. It rotates out of risk-on assets and into the perceived safety of the dollar, draining the pools. The current correlation matrix is unusual. Long-term bond yields are surging. That usually means the market is pricing in either stronger growth or higher inflation. But the economic signals are pointing to slowdown. That contradiction is the key. It suggests the market is not pricing a soft landing. It is pricing fiscal dominance. It is pricing a scenario where the government must continue to issue debt, and the only buyer at the end of the day will be the central bank. That is a very different risk profile. For crypto, this is a double-edged sword. In the short term, a spike in long-term yields is a headwind for risk assets. The 'risk-free' rate is the denominator in every valuation model, and it's rising. But in the medium term, the same fiscal strain that raises yields often forces a search for alternative assets. It's a timing game, and the signals are confusing. Here is where the analysis diverges from the consensus. The market is treating the Jackson Hole speech as a source of clarity. I am treating it as a source of volatility. The data suggests that Fed Chair is intentionally reducing the communication toolkit. This isn't a rookie mistake. It's a strategy to regain flexibility. But it has a side effect. It removes the 'guide' from the market. The machine runs on expectations. If you take away the manual, the machine runs on pure price discovery. And pure price discovery is noisy. My analysis of the on-chain data over the last 30 days shows that large holders are not betting on direction. They are buying hedges. The options flow on the major exchanges is showing a skew towards tail-risk protection. This is not a signal of a crash. It is a signal of uncertainty. The market is paying for a floor. The secret of the ledger is in the details. The Treasury's expanded buyback program is not just a technical tool. It is a policy move. When the Treasury buys back bonds, it is effectively managing the yield curve. It is trying to inject liquidity into a specific part of the market. This is a soft form of yield curve control. It doesn't go through the Fed's balance sheet, but it aims to achieve a similar result. The problem is that this creates a contradiction. The Fed is trying to reduce its presence in the market. The Treasury is trying to increase its presence. This is the definition of conflicting signals. The market has to decide which one to believe. The resulting uncertainty is the underlying volatility we are seeing. We can see the impact of this in the crypto markets. The price action is not driven by a single narrative. It's driven by a tug-of-war between macro forces. The short-term direction is unpredictable. But the medium-term setup is becoming clear. The market is preparing for a world where the Fed is not the backstop for risk. That is a new regime. I've been auditing the behavior of the largest holders. The flow is not exiting the system. It is rotating. Large holders are moving assets from the more volatile, higher-beta assets into the more stable, blue-chip assets. This is a risk-off rotation within the crypto space itself. It's not a wholesale exit. It's a shift in the hierarchy. This is the part that I find most contrarian. The common narrative is that crypto acts as a hedge against fiscal irresponsibility. The data suggests that crypto is still acting as a high-beta proxy for the tech sector. When the long-term yield spikes, it hits crypto harder than it hits gold. The correlation to Nasdaq is still higher than the correlation to gold. The ledger shows that the 'digital gold' narrative is not yet supported by the trading data. It is a story. The trading behavior is a different story. This is the critical blind spot. The market is expecting the Fed to blink. It is expecting the Treasury to rescue. But the data suggests both entities are boxed in. The Fed cannot cut without reigniting inflation. The Treasury cannot stop borrowing without causing a severe recession. They are stuck. The market is pricing the consequences of this trap. That's not a healthy dynamic. My next week's signal is simple: watch the 10-year yield. The on-chain flow will follow. If the yield breaks decisively above the psychological 5% level, I expect a sharp migration out of the risk assets. If it retreats, we might see a relief rally. But the key is not to predict the direction. The key is to listen to the signal. The data is showing a liquidity risk. The narrative is showing a policy risk. The risk is the same.
